    I got a Black Friday deal on a CZ 712 G2 shotgun two years ago from Midway USA. I love the gun and it runs extremely well. I added a mag extension and front rail all for less than $500 because I got the gun for such a good price. As long as I ensure the rounds are in the 1250 FPS range or higher it runs great. I have done two classes with it and multiple competitions. I would like to upgrade two things and need advice on the best routes.

    First, there is currently no way to attach a sling to the rear. I added a rail to the magazine clamp so I have a QD mount for the front end but there are no studs or anything on the buttstock. Will a hollow plastic/synthetic stock hold a screw in sling stud? I would really like to mount attachment on the right hand side of stock so I can carry it on the front like an AR. Will it hold? I have also wondered about simply drilling hole all the way through the stock and running paracord through that I could then attach sling to. Alternatively are there any ready made straps/harnesses to do what I want?

    Second, the receiver is not set up for a rear sight. No screw holes or rail. Is there any reason not to have someone drill and tap holes or better yet machine in a red dot mount like the new Mossberg 940?

    Budget is a limitation obviously or I would simply have bought the Berretta 1301 (Mossberg 940 and new Berretta 300 are triple the price of my gun, so upgrading is not an option at the moment).

    Thanks for any ideas or advice. I am also interested in gunsmiths in the central Indiana area (I live in Boone County) to do the work.
